Audio: Rory Gallagher: ‘We played some good football but didn’t finish off our scoring opportunites’

written by Alan Foley July 19, 2015
FacebookTweetLinkedInEmailPrint

DONEGAL manager Rory Gallagher cut a disappointed figure outside of the St Tiernach’s Park dressing rooms in Clones this afternoon after his side went narrowly down to a 0-11 to 0-10 defeat to Monaghan in the Ulster final.

Gallagher felt the key phase in the contest was when Malachy O’Rourke’s Monaghan finished out the first half in commanding style to lead 0-8 to 0-4 at the interval.

Donegal dominated the chances in the second half, scoring six points to Monaghan’s three, but 11 wides in that period essentially undid any hopes of a fourth Ulster SFC title in five seasons.
